Location and Accessibility

Burr Oak Road is located in Glouster, OH 45732, USA. This address places it squarely within the picturesque landscape of southeastern Ohio, a region known for its rugged beauty, dense forests, and clear lakes. More specifically, Burr Oak Road is the primary access point for Burr Oak State Park, a sprawling natural area that offers diverse recreational opportunities and camping facilities.

Glouster, situated in Athens and Morgan Counties, benefits from its position amidst the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ains. This geographical setting provides a tranquil and secluded environment, making it an ideal retreat for those looking to escape the urban hustle. Despite its serene backdrop, the area is accessible via well-maintained state routes, ensuring a relatively smooth journey for visitors from various parts of Ohio. State Route 78, a scenic highway, is a key artery providing access to Glouster and the Burr Oak State Park area.

The proximity of Burr Oak Road to Burr Oak State Park Lodge and Conference Center (located at 10660 Burr Oak Lodge Road, Glouster, OH 45732) further enhances its accessibility and appeal. While Burr Oak Road itself refers to the road leading to the park and its various camping sections, the park's well-established infrastructure means that visitors can easily navigate to their chosen camping areas. For Ohio residents, this location offers a convenient drive, minimizing travel time and maximizing the duration of their outdoor adventure. The combination of its natural seclusion and practical accessibility makes Burr Oak Road a desirable destination for both casual campers and dedicated outdoor enthusiasts.

Services Offered

The camping experience at Burr Oak Road, largely centered around Burr Oak State Park, provides a comprehensive array of services designed to accommodate various camping styles and preferences. While specific private campgrounds might exist along the road, the state park campground is the primary offering, ensuring a standardized level of quality and amenity. Here are the typical services available:

  • Campsites: Both electric and non-electric sites are available, catering to RVs, travel trailers, and tent campers. Some sites are designated as "tent-only" due to their size or location, offering a more traditional camping feel.
  • Restroom Facilities: Clean and well-maintained flush toilets and hot showers are provided in the main campground area, ensuring comfort for all visitors.
  • Dump Station: A convenient dump station is available for RV campers, allowing for proper waste disposal.
  • Potable Water: Access to fresh, potable water is available throughout the campground, with main fill-up points near the back end of the campground.
  • Pet-Friendly Sites: A limit of two pets are allowed on designated sites, making it possible for furry family members to join the adventure.
  • Reservations: Reservations are highly recommended, especially during peak seasons, and can be made up to six months in advance online or by phone.

These services ensure that campers have access to necessary facilities, allowing them to focus on enjoying the natural beauty and recreational activities the area has to offer.

Features / Highlights

The area around Burr Oak Road and Burr Oak State Park is rich with features and highlights that promise a fulfilling outdoor experience for all visitors. The park itself is a blend of rustic charm and modern conveniences, offering a wide array of activities:

  • Burr Oak Lake: The centerpiece of the park, this 664-acre lake permits boating with motors of 10 HP or less, with larger motors allowed at idle speed/no wake. Several boat launch ramps provide easy access, and seasonal dock rentals are available. The lake is well-known for fishing, with plentiful catches of largemouth bass, crappie, bluegill, and channel catfish. Accessible fishing is available at Dock #4.
  • Extensive Trail System: Many miles of hiking trails wind through the park, including a scenic half-mile Storybook Trail near the lodge and recreation area. The Burr Oak State Park Backpack Trail is a more challenging 21.9-mile route, with designated campsites along the way.
  • Archery Range: A static archery range is located near the campground, offering targets at various distances for archers to hone their skills (field points only).
  • Disc Golf Course: An 18-hole disc golf course is available near the Nature Center, providing a fun and challenging activity for all ages.
  • Swimming Beach: A 500-foot public swimming beach on the north side of the lake offers a perfect spot for swimming and sunbathing, complete with restrooms and outdoor showers.
  • Picnic Areas and Shelterhouses: Various picnic areas with tables and grills are available, and a reservable shelterhouse can be booked for gatherings.
  • Wildlife Viewing and Hunting: The park and adjacent wildlife areas, including sections of Wayne National Forest, permit hunting in designated areas (with a valid Ohio hunting license). The diverse ecosystem also provides excellent opportunities for birdwatching and wildlife observation.
  • Burr Oak State Park Lodge & Conference Center: Located across the lake, the lodge offers full-service amenities including a restaurant, lounge, gift shop, indoor swimming pool, tennis courts, miniature golf, and additional recreational facilities, providing a comfortable option for those seeking a break from camping.

These features collectively make Burr Oak Road and its surrounding park a versatile destination, ensuring there's something for everyone to enjoy in the heart of Ohio's natural beauty.

Promotions or Special Offers

Burr Oak State Park and the associated Burr Oak Lodge & Conference Center frequently offer various promotions and discounts to make visits more accessible and appealing. While specific campground promotions might vary seasonally, general offers commonly available for Ohio State Parks and Lodges include:

  • Golden Buckeye Card Discount: Ohio residents aged 60 and over with a Golden Buckeye Card can receive a 50% discount on camping fees Sunday through Thursday, and a 10% discount on Friday and Saturday. A 10% discount also applies to other overnight and day-use rentals.
  • Active/Retired Military Discount: A 10% discount off overnight facility rates is available to active and retired military personnel every night of the week, regardless of their home state.
  • Disabled Veteran/POW Free Camping Pass: Honorably discharged Ohio resident veterans who are former Prisoners of War or permanently and totally disabled veterans receiving comp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s may qualify for a free camping pass. (Note: A $6.50 reservation fee still applies).
  • Ohio Wildlife Legacy Stamp Discount: Holders of the Ohio Wildlife Legacy Stamp receive a 25% discount off lodge room or cabin rates.
  • Ohio Fishing/Hunting/Trapping License Discount: Customers with a valid Ohio fishing, hunting, or trapping license receive a 10% discount off lodge room or cabin rates.
  • Seasonal and Limited-Time Offers: The Burr Oak Lodge & Conference Center often provides limited-time specials and year-round offers, which can include discounts for extended stays (e.g., "Stay More, Save More" for 3+ nights), or packages tied to specific events or seasons.

To ensure you receive the most current and relevant promotions, it is always recommended to check the official Ohio Department of Natural Resources (ODNR) website for Burr Oak State Park or the Burr Oak Lodge & Conference Center website directly before making reservations.
